The name of the ship, Aeolus , is the film's thematic skeleton key. In Greek mythology, Aeolus is the father of Sisyphus—the man condemned by the gods to push a boulder up a hill for eternity, only to watch it roll back down just as it reaches the top. The 2009 psychological thriller Triangle , directed by Christopher Smith, stands as one of the most intricately constructed puzzle films of the 2000s. While it initially slipped under the mainstream radar, the film has achieved a massive cult status over the years. Triangle is a rare breed of thriller that gets better with every single viewing. Once you know the ending, watching the film a second time reveals a completely different story. You begin to notice the subtle cues, the tragic inevitability of Jess's choices, and the horrific realization that her ultimate act of love is the very thing that seals her eternal damnation.
